Aspects Affecting Roof Prices



When you're thinking about a brand-new roof covering, a number of factors can influence the overall expense. Initially, the dimension of your roof covering plays a crucial function. Larger roof coverings require more materials and labor, driving up expenses.

Next off, the complexity of your roofing's layout issues. If your roof has multiple inclines, valleys, or special attributes, installation can come to be a lot more challenging and costly.

Labor prices likewise differ based on your place and the availability of skilled workers. Areas with greater need for roof solutions frequently see raised labor prices.

Additionally, the timing of your job can influence costs, as roofing business may provide lower costs throughout the offseason.

One more key element is the problem of your existing roof covering. If you need to remove old products or make repair services before mounting a brand-new roof, those added jobs will certainly raise your general budget.

Finally, your option of roofing system can impact costs, as some choices may require specific installment strategies.

Recognizing these elements aids you prepare for the financial commitment of a brand-new roof. Sorts Of Roof Materials



Choosing the best roof product is vital for both the looks and durability of your home. You have actually got numerous choices, each with its very own advantages and downsides.

Asphalt roof shingles are one of the most preferred option because of their cost and simple setup. They are available in different colors and styles, making it easy to match your home's exterior.

Steel roofing is one more exceptional option, known for its long life and resistance to extreme weather conditions. While it might come with a higher initial price, its longevity usually brings about financial savings in the future.

If you're searching for a much more green choice, take into consideration shingles made from recycled products and even a green roofing system with living plants.

Clay and concrete tiles offer a distinctive, traditional appearance that enhances aesthetic allure. However, they can be heavy and may call for added architectural assistance.

If you favor an unique look, slate roof supplies a glamorous coating but can be rather expensive and tough to install.

Ultimately, your selection must mirror your budget plan, climate, and individual design. Take your time to weigh the advantages and disadvantages before making a decision.

Recognizing Labor Expenditures



Labor expenses can substantially affect the general cost of your roof covering project. When you employ a contractor, you're not just spending for their time; you're likewise covering their know-how and the skills of their crew. Normally, labor expenses can represent 60% to 70% of your overall roof costs, so comprehending these expenses is vital.

Different elements affect labor expenditures. The intricacy of your roofing system plays a large role-- steeper roofings or those with multiple aspects need even more ability and time, causing greater labor costs.
